Quake-affected families in the Philippines now over 155,000

MANILA, Oct 6 — The number of families affected by the magnitude 6.9 earthquake that rocked Bogo City, Cebu, and other nearby areas on Tuesday (September 30), has now reached over 155,000, according to the official government tally as of today.

The Philippine News Agency (PNA) quoted the National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council's (NDRRMC) report, which said that all the 155,094 affected families, or 547,394 individuals, are from Central Visayas.

72 people were reported killed and 559 others were reported injured, all undergoing validation and verification as of the time of the report.

It has yet to release estimates on the infrastructure and agriculture damage resulting from the earthquake.

Regarding assistance to the victims, the NDRRMC said that the Social Welfare and Development Department (DSWD) has already provided ₱93.52 million worth of food (RM6.76 million) and non-food items, with 187,858 families receiving family food packs as of yesterday
